The documents that are stored in the data room are crucial to the success of any business. Whether you’re looking to raise funds from investors or close an acquisition, having the appropriate data available will help speed up due diligence, minimize risk and ensure the integrity of sensitive information throughout the process.

When structuring your data room to be used for due diligence, consider who you are preparing to share information with. It is important to comprehend the types of files and folders these people will be looking through to make your data room easier for them to navigate. For example, if your audience is mostly comprised of lawyers and bankers You may want to create folders specifically for financial documents such as legal documents, contracts and other legal documents.

Label documents and folders clearly. This will let you track who is accessing what data and when, which will help you avoid sharing without authorization or re-use of your data. You’ll also want to keep your dataroom up-to-date and maintained regularly to ensure that your data is up-to-date and accurate. This can be accomplished by including audit logs, which provide a complete history of all document activity. This includes the date and time at which and how many people accessed the file.
